The Teriyaki Chicken: A Flavorful Star
The teriyaki chicken in this recipe is the true star of the dish, bringing deep, savory flavors that are further enhanced by the sweet and tangy teriyaki sauce. Marinated in a blend of sesame oil, soy sauce, rice vinegar, and brown sugar, the chicken thighs absorb the rich flavors of the marinade, ensuring that every bite is juicy and tender. Grilled or pan-seared to perfection, the chicken is then brushed with a thick, glossy layer of teriyaki sauce that caramelizes during cooking, creating a beautiful, flavorful crust on the outside.
Chicken thighs are the ideal cut for this dish, as they offer more fat and moisture than chicken breasts, resulting in a juicier and more flavorful bite. The slight char and smoky flavor from grilling or pan-searing make the teriyaki-glazed chicken even more irresistible. For those who enjoy a bit of heat, the red pepper flakes in the marinade provide a subtle kick that contrasts perfectly with the sweetness of the teriyaki sauce, enhancing the overall flavor profile of the dish.
Garlic Noodles: A Rich and Creamy Comfort
The garlic noodles serve as the perfect base for the teriyaki chicken, offering a creamy and savory contrast to the sweet and tangy chicken. Cooked udon noodles are coated in a velvety butter sauce, rich with the flavors of garlic, soy sauce, and oyster sauce. Udon noodles, with their thick and chewy texture, are a perfect match for this rich, flavorful sauce, allowing every bite to absorb the creamy mixture.
The garlic butter sauce is a key component of this dish, starting with sautéed garlic that adds depth and aroma to the dish. The combination of soy sauce, oyster sauce, and heavy cream creates a balanced sauce that is both savory and slightly sweet. The addition of parmesan cheese enriches the sauce with a subtle sharpness, and a touch of white sugar helps to mellow the flavors, creating a harmonious balance of salty, creamy, and umami notes.
As the noodles are tossed in the sauce, they soak up all the flavors, resulting in a dish that feels indulgent yet comforting. The rich, creamy coating contrasts with the tender, slightly chewy texture of the udon noodles, creating a satisfying mouthfeel that complements the flavorful teriyaki chicken on top.

Versatility and Customization
While the recipe for Garlic Noodles with Teriyaki Chicken is already incredibly delicious, it also offers room for customization based on personal preferences or dietary restrictions. For those who prefer a spicier dish, additional red pepper flakes or a dash of sriracha can be added to the teriyaki sauce or the noodle sauce, providing an extra layer of heat to balance out the sweetness. Alternatively, if you prefer a more subtle flavor profile, you can adjust the amount of brown sugar or soy sauce in the sauce to suit your taste.
Vegetarians or those seeking a lighter option can swap the chicken for tofu, which soaks up the flavors of the teriyaki sauce beautifully. Grilled or pan-seared tofu can be glazed with the same teriyaki sauce, offering a delicious plant-based alternative that pairs wonderfully with the creamy garlic noodles.
For a more vibrant dish, feel free to add vegetables such as bell peppers, broccoli, or spinach. These vegetables can be sautéed or roasted and added to the noodles, adding both color and nutrition to the meal. This dish is versatile and can be adjusted based on what ingredients are available or what flavors you prefer, making it an easy go-to for any occasion.
Pairing Suggestions
Given the rich and savory nature of Garlic Noodles with Teriyaki Chicken, pairing the dish with a refreshing beverage can help balance out the flavors. A chilled glass of white wine, such as a Sauvignon Blanc or Pinot Grigio, works well with the dish’s creamy noodles and savory chicken, as the acidity of the wine complements the richness of the garlic butter sauce.
For those who prefer non-alcoholic options, a cold iced tea with a squeeze of lemon is a great choice, offering a refreshing contrast to the savory flavors of the dish. Alternatively, a sparkling water with a splash of lime adds a crisp, clean note that enhances the overall dining experience.
